Guia Completo de Instalação do Nagios

Bem-vindo ao seu guia completo de instalação do Nagios. Se você está procurando soluções eficazes para monitorar sua rede, o Nagios é uma das melhores opções disponíveis. Este software open-source é altamente personalizável, oferece monitoramento de rede em tempo real e solução de problemas para qualquer tipo de infraestrutura. Neste guia passo a passo, você aprenderá tudo o que precisa para configurar e personalizar o Nagios de acordo com suas necessidades. Vamos começar!

Leia mais

O que é o Nagios?

O Nagios é uma ferramenta de monitoramento de rede que ajuda a garantir que todos os sistemas, serviços e aplicativos em sua infraestrutura de TI funcionem sem problemas. Ele é projetado para empregar uma abordagem proativa, notificando os administradores do sistema sobre problemas antes que eles se tornem críticos.

Leia mais

O Nagios é uma solução altamente personalizável que permite aos usuários monitorar qualquer tipo de recurso de rede, incluindo servidores, roteadores, switches, impressoras e aplicativos. Ele pode monitorar serviços como HTTP, SSH, SMTP, entre outros.

Leia mais

O Nagios é uma ferramenta de código aberto, o que significa que você tem acesso ao código-fonte e pode personalizá-lo para atender às suas necessidades específicas de monitoramento de rede.

Leia mais

Pré-requisitos para a instalação do Nagios

Antes de instalar o Nagios, é importante verificar se o seu sistema atende aos seguintes pré-requisitos:

Leia mais
  • Sistema operacional compatível: Linux, BSD ou Unix
  • Usuário com permissões de root ou sudo
  • Acesso à internet para download e instalação de pacotes
  • Pacotes necessários: Apache, PHP, GCC, GD, C e C++ compilers, entre outros. Verifique a documentação oficial para a versão específica.
Leia mais

É importante garantir que o sistema esteja atualizado e configurado corretamente antes de começar a instalar o Nagios. Além disso, é recomendável fazer um backup dos arquivos e configurações importantes antes de prosseguir.

Leia mais

Pré-requisitos para a instalação do Nagios no Ubuntu

Caso esteja utilizando o Ubuntu, siga os seguintes passos para garantir os pré-requisitos necessários:

Leia mais
  1. Atualize o sistema: sudo apt-get update && sudo apt-get upgrade
  2. Instale os pacotes necessários: sudo apt-get install build-essential apache2 php libgd-dev libapache2-mod-php7.4 openssl libssl-dev
  3. Crie um usuário e grupo nagios: sudo useradd nagios && sudo groupadd nagcmd && sudo usermod -aG nagcmd nagios
  4. Baixe a última versão do Nagios Core: wget https://github.com/NagiosEnterprises/nagioscore/releases/download/nagios-4.4.6/nagios-4.4.6.tar.gz
  5. Extraia o arquivo baixado: tar -xf nagios-4.4.6.tar.gz
Leia mais

Com esses pré-requisitos atendidos, agora você está pronto para começar a instalar o Nagios. No próximo tópico, explicaremos passo a passo como realizar a instalação.

Leia mais

Passo a passo da instalação do Nagios

Antes de proceder com a instalação do Nagios, certifique-se de ter um servidor Linux compatível com o Nagios e de ter as seguintes dependências instaladas:

Leia mais
  • Apache
  • PHP
  • MySQL
  • Plugins do Nagios
Leia mais

Com as dependências instaladas, siga os passos abaixo para instalar o Nagios:

Leia mais
  1. Faça o download do Nagios Core no site oficial e extraia os arquivos.
  2. Abra o terminal e navegue até o diretório onde os arquivos foram extraídos.
  3. Execute o comando ./configure para verificar se todas as dependências estão instaladas corretamente.
  4. Se o comando anterior não retornar nenhum erro, execute o comando make all para compilar o Nagios.
  5. Execute o comando sudo make install para instalar o Nagios.
  6. Agora, execute os comandos a seguir para instalar o Nagios Service Check Acceptor (NSCA):
Leia mais
ComandoDescrição
cd ~/Downloads/nagios-plugins-*Navega até o diretório onde os plugins do Nagios foram extraídos.
./configure --with-nagios-user=nagios --with-nagios-group=nagios --enable-command-argsConfigura o NSCA para ser executado pelo usuário e grupo do Nagios.
makeCompila o NSCA.
sudo make installInstala o NSCA.
Leia mais

A instalação do Nagios e do NSCA está completa. Agora, é necessário configurar o Nagios no servidor.

Leia mais

Configurando o Nagios no servidor

Agora que você instalou o Nagios, é hora de configurá-lo para monitorar os hosts e serviços da sua rede. Para isso, será necessário criar e modificar alguns arquivos de configuração.

Leia mais

O arquivo principal de configuração do Nagios é o nagios.cfg, localizado em /usr/local/nagios/etc/. Este arquivo contém configurações globais, como definições de diretórios e contatos de notificação. É importante editar este arquivo com cuidado e atenção aos detalhes.

Leia mais

Outro arquivo crucial é o objects/commands.cfg, que contém definições de comandos usados pelo Nagios para executar verificações. Neste arquivo, você pode definir novos comandos ou personalizar os existentes de acordo com suas necessidades.

Leia mais

Além disso, você precisará criar arquivos de configuração para hosts e serviços. Esses arquivos são encontrados em objects/, e você pode modificar ou criar novos arquivos para monitorar os dispositivos e serviços de sua rede.

Leia mais

Para verificar se as configurações estão corretas e o Nagios está funcionando como desejado, execute o comando abaixo:

Leia mais

Se o comando retornar "Configuration OK", você está pronto para iniciar o Nagios:

Leia mais

Com o Nagios em execução, você pode acessar a interface da web em um navegador usando o endereço IP do servidor seguido por "/nagios". Faça o login com as credenciais definidas durante a instalação.

Leia mais

Agora você pode adicionar hosts e serviços para monitorar no Nagios, editar as configurações de notificação e personalizar o layout da interface da web. O Nagios oferece muitas opções de personalização, permitindo que você ajuste o monitoramento de acordo com as necessidades específicas de sua rede.

Leia mais

Com este guia completo de instalação e configuração do Nagios, você deve estar pronto para implementar o monitoramento de rede eficaz em seu ambiente. Lembre-se de manter suas configurações atualizadas e monitorar regularmente os relatórios de status para garantir a integridade de sua infraestrutura.

Leia mais

Personalizando o Nagios

Uma das grandes vantagens do Nagios é a possibilidade de personalização. É possível, por exemplo, incluir plugins específicos para atender às necessidades do seu ambiente, criar novos relatórios, definir grupos de usuários por perfil de acesso, entre outras possibilidades.

Leia mais

Para customizar o Nagios, é preciso navegar pelo diretório raiz do Nagios e encontrar os arquivos que precisam ser alterados. Um dos arquivos que pode ser personalizado é o nagios.cfg, utilizado para configurar as principais opções do Nagios.

Leia mais

Além disso, é possível personalizar a interface do usuário do Nagios, alterando o tema padrão, adicionando atalhos para funcionalidades específicas, entre outras opções. Para isso, é necessário ter conhecimento em HTML, CSS e JavaScript.

Leia mais

Outra opção de personalização é a inclusão de plugins. Existem diversos plugins disponíveis na web que podem ser baixados e instalados no Nagios para atender a necessidades específicas.

Leia mais

É importante destacar que a customização do Nagios deve ser feita com cautela, pois alterações mal executadas podem prejudicar o funcionamento da ferramenta e, consequentemente, o monitoramento.

Leia mais

Monitoramento Eficaz com o Nagios

O Nagios é uma ferramenta de monitoramento essencial para garantir que seus sistemas estejam sempre funcionando corretamente. Com o Nagios, você pode monitorar e alertar sobre problemas em tempo real, para que possa solucioná-los imediatamente e evitar interrupções no serviço.

Leia mais

Veja como o Nagios pode ajudar a monitorar seu ambiente:

Leia mais

Monitoramento contínuo

O Nagios monitora continuamente seus sistemas em busca de problemas, verificando regularmente o desempenho e a integridade do sistema. Isso garante que você seja alertado imediatamente sobre quaisquer problemas que possam ocorrer.

Leia mais

Alertas em tempo real

Com o Nagios, você pode configurar alertas em tempo real para notificá-lo instantaneamente sobre quaisquer problemas que possam ocorrer. Isso permite que você solucione os problemas imediatamente, minimizando o tempo de inatividade.

Leia mais

Relatórios detalhados

O Nagios fornece relatórios detalhados sobre o desempenho do sistema e quaisquer problemas que tenham ocorrido. Isso permite que você monitore o progresso e tome medidas para melhorar o desempenho do sistema no futuro.

Leia mais

Personalização completa

O Nagios é altamente personalizável, permitindo que você ajuste as configurações e alertas de acordo com suas necessidades específicas. Isso torna o Nagios a escolha ideal para empresas de todos os tamanhos e setores.

Leia mais

Com o Nagios, você tem a garantia de monitoramento eficaz e confiável de seus sistemas, permitindo que você mantenha seus negócios em pleno funcionamento.

Leia mais

Solução de Problemas com o Nagios

Como com qualquer software de monitoramento, é sempre possível encontrar alguns problemas ao usar o Nagios. Felizmente, a maioria dos problemas pode ser resolvida com algumas dicas simples.

Leia mais

Problema: Alertas não estão sendo enviados

Se você configurou o Nagios para enviar alertas, mas eles não estão sendo entregues, verifique o arquivo de log de alerta para ver se há erros. Certifique-se de que o Nagios esteja configurado corretamente para enviar alertas e que as configurações de email estejam corretas.

Leia mais

Problema: Verificação de serviço falha

Se a verificação de serviço falhar, verifique o status do host e do serviço em questão. Verifique as configurações do Nagios para garantir que elas estejam corretas. Certifique-se de que o host e o serviço estejam em execução e que você não está enfrentando problemas com conectividade de rede.

Leia mais

Problema: Muitos alertas falsos

Se você estiver recebendo muitos alertas falsos, isso pode ser devido a configurações de limiar muito baixas. Ajuste as configurações de limiar para garantir que você não esteja recebendo alertas falsos.

Leia mais

Problema: Problemas com a interface gráfica do usuário (GUI)

Se você estiver tendo problemas com a interface gráfica do usuário (GUI), verifique se o Nagios está sendo executado corretamente em seu servidor. Certifique-se de que a versão da web do Nagios seja compatível com o seu navegador. Além disso, verifique as configurações do Apache para garantir que elas estejam corretas.

Leia mais

Seguindo estas dicas simples, você pode resolver a maioria dos problemas que possa enfrentar ao usar o Nagios. Se você ainda estiver com problemas, pode encontrar ajuda em fóruns online ou através do suporte do Nagios.

Leia mais

Integração do Nagios com outras ferramentas

O Nagios é uma ferramenta de monitoramento que pode ser integrada com outras ferramentas para melhorar ainda mais o gerenciamento da infraestrutura. Algumas das principais integrações realizadas com o Nagios são:

Leia mais

Integração do Nagios com o Grafana

O Grafana é uma plataforma de análise e visualização de dados que pode ser integrada ao Nagios para aprimorar ainda mais o monitoramento do sistema. Com o Grafana, é possível gerar relatórios mais detalhados e gráficos dinâmicos que facilitam a visualização e o entendimento das informações coletadas pelo Nagios.

Leia mais

Para realizar a integração entre as duas ferramentas, é necessário configurar o Nagios para enviar dados para o Grafana e, em seguida, instalar e configurar o plugin do Nagios para o Grafana. O processo pode ser um pouco complexo, mas existem diversas documentações disponíveis na internet que podem ajudar.

Leia mais

Integração do Nagios com o Slack

O Slack é uma ferramenta de comunicação em equipe que pode ser integrada ao Nagios para enviar alertas de monitoramento em tempo real para os usuários. Com essa integração, é possível receber notificações diretamente no Slack sempre que ocorrer um problema ou uma falha na infraestrutura monitorada.

Leia mais

Para realizar a integração entre as duas ferramentas, é necessário configurar o Nagios para enviar os alertas para o Slack e, em seguida, criar um canal no Slack para receber as notificações. O processo é relativamente simples e é possível encontrar diversas documentações disponíveis na internet para ajudar.

Leia mais

Integração do Nagios com o Puppet

O Puppet é uma ferramenta de gerenciamento de configuração que pode ser integrada ao Nagios para automatizar a resolução de problemas de infraestrutura. Com essa integração, é possível configurar o Puppet para realizar a correção de falhas detectadas pelo Nagios automaticamente, sem a necessidade de intervenção humana.

Leia mais

Para realizar a integração entre as duas ferramentas, é necessário configurar o Nagios para enviar os alertas para o Puppet e, em seguida, criar um script de correção de problemas que será executado pelo Puppet. O processo pode ser um pouco complexo e requer conhecimentos avançados em programação e automação de sistemas.

Leia mais

Essas são apenas algumas das principais integrações que podem ser realizadas com o Nagios. Existem diversas outras ferramentas que podem ser integradas ao Nagios para aprimorar o monitoramento e o gerenciamento da infraestrutura de TI.

Leia mais

Atualizações e Suporte do Nagios

O Nagios é uma ferramenta de monitoramento de código aberto que está em constante evolução e atualização. A comunidade de desenvolvedores e usuários está sempre trabalhando para melhorar o Nagios e manter o suporte ao longo do tempo.

Leia mais

Para manter-se atualizado sobre as últimas versões do Nagios e correções de bugs, é recomendável acessar o site oficial e verificar as atualizações disponíveis. Além disso, muitos usuários contribuem com plugins e patches em fóruns e grupos de discussão, o que pode ser bastante útil para personalizar a ferramenta de acordo com as necessidades específicas de cada empresa.

Leia mais
VersionReleasedEnd of life
Nagios 4.4.611/10/2020Unknown
Nagios 4.4.518/05/2020Unknown
Nagios 4.4.424/10/2019Unknown
Leia mais

O suporte para o Nagios pode ser encontrado em vários fóruns online, onde usuários experientes e a comunidade em geral oferecem ajuda e solução para problemas específicos. Além disso, empresas especializadas em monitoramento também oferecem suporte pago para o Nagios e outras ferramentas de monitoramento.

Leia mais

Em resumo, o Nagios é uma ferramenta confiável e atualizável que tem se mostrado essencial para empresas de todos os setores. Com suporte da comunidade e empresas especializadas, é possível utilizar o Nagios para monitorar todos os aspectos de seu ambiente de TI e garantir um monitoramento eficaz e seguro.

Leia mais

Conclusão

Em resumo, o Nagios é uma ferramenta poderosa para monitorar sua infraestrutura de TI e, com nossas instruções, você pode instalá-lo facilmente em seu servidor. Certifique-se de que seus pré-requisitos estejam em ordem e siga nossos passos cuidadosamente para evitar problemas durante a instalação.

Leia mais

Depois de instalado, você pode personalizar seu Nagios e configurá-lo para atender às suas necessidades específicas, além de monitorar eficazmente seus sistemas e solucionar problemas com facilidade.

Leia mais

Mesmo que você encontre problemas, lembre-se de que o Nagios tem uma forte comunidade de suporte e atualizações frequentes para manter sua ferramenta funcionando sem problemas.

Leia mais

Por fim, a integração do Nagios com outras ferramentas é uma ótima maneira de expandir seus recursos de monitoramento e melhorar ainda mais sua eficácia.

Leia mais

Não hesite em experimentar o Nagios e descubra como pode ajudá-lo a manter um ambiente de TI saudável e eficiente.

Leia mais

Gostou deste story?

Aproveite para compartilhar clicando no botão acima!

Visite nosso site e veja todos os outros artigos disponíveis!

Guia Linux